The West Texas region is a sprawling area that can loosely be classified as comprising the counties around the main metro areas of El Paso, Lubbock, Abilene, Midland/Odessa and San Angelo. The total value of ranches, farms, hunting land and other rural land and acreage for sale in Lamb County, Texas, recently on Land.com was around $32 million. This represents 2,000 acres of ranches, farms, hunting land and other rural land and acreage for sale in Lamb County. Lamb County ranks 190th in Texas for the combined amount of land currently advertised for sale. Of all land for sale in Lamb County, Littlefield had the most land for sale. Its economy is defined as agricultural, with 933 farms recorded in the county during the most recent U.S. Census. Farming activities in Lamb County generate annual revenues of $33 million, the majority of which comes from livestock products. Lamb County is the 78th largest county (1,017 square miles) in Texas. It's located in the South Plains Texas region of Texas.
